Analysis

The most recent figure for crop residue removal — cropland nitrogen per unit area in Thailand is 8.53 kg/ha, measured in 2023.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 2.1% on the previous year and down 13.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, crop residue removal — cropland nitrogen per unit area in Thailand peaked at 10.14 kg/ha in 2011 and was at its lowest, 5 kg/ha, in 1990.

Thailand ranks 102nd of 201 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
